Footwear maker Alpina cutting workforce, moving part of production

Žiri, 13 August - Alpina, the Slovenian-based sports footwear maker in Czech ownership, plans to lay off 60 employees at its main location in Žiri by the end of the year, the decision coming after one of its two production units in Bosnia-Herzegovina was shut down at the end of July.
